Clare Howard, a researcher with Heritage England, has written a monograph on the life and work of Pearson who is best known for designing Truro Cathedral. She will be focusing on two of his churches in Hove: the monumental All Saints’ Church on the corner of Grand Avenue and Eaton Road—where this lecture will be held—and the more modest but equally interesting church of St Barnabas in Sackville Road.
